Golf Conditioning Clinic

This exercise class is designed to keep you healthy for the entire golf season. Stay healthy and improve performance for the golf season. You’ll learn proper warm-up, strengthening and stretching activities. This clinic is designed by physical therapists using the latest research which has been shown to reduce injuries and improve performance

Meghan Coughlin

Meghan Coughlin, PTA, ATC, is a physical therapist assistant with Emerson's Clough Family Center for Rehabilitative and Sports therapies. She has more than 20 years of experience in secondary schools and outpatient orthopedic settings treating high school, college and professional athletes. She graduated from the University of Massachusetts Amherst with a bachelor’s in exercise science and earned an associate’s degree from Bay State College as a physical therapist assistant. Meghan holds a master’s in sports medicine from the United States Sports Academy and is certified by the National Athletic Trainers Association. Her clinical interests include orthopedic and sports rehabilitation, management and prevention of running injuries, yoga therapy and prevention and rehab of ACL injuries.
